Have you ever had a conversation with an Olympian where they tell you what their secret was to winning an Olympic Medal?? I was lucky enough to do just that recently and I'm thrilled to share my conversation with Olympic Super Hero, Paul Wylie. He lives in Charlotte, North Carolina with his lovely wife, Kate, and their three amazing kids.

Paul won the Silver Medal for the USA in Mens Figure Skating at the 1992 Winter Olympics in Albertville, France. The thing is though, he was the underdog... but he focused his energy and opened himself up to the possibility of actually winning!

He talks about how he put himself in a grateful state of mind, even when it doesn't come naturally... sharing his process on how to accomplish what you set out to do.
